A simple and sensitive RP-HPLC method for the determination of parecoxib (PXB) in human plasma and pharmaceutical formulations has been developed and validated. The separation of PXB and the internal standard, ibuprofen (IBF) was achieved on a CLC C-18 (5 mu, 25 cm x 4.6 mm i.d.) column using UV detector at 200 nm. The mobile phase consisted of acetonitrile-water (92: 8 v/v). The linear range of detection was found to be 0.9-18.4 mu g/ml (r = 0.9985). Intra-and inter-day assay relative standard deviations were observed to be less than 0.3%. The method has been applied successfully for the determination of PXB in spiked human plasma and pharmaceutical preparations. Analytical parameters were calculated and complete statistical evaluation is incorporated.
